Presentation is loading. Please wait.

Presentation is loading. Please wait.

About me About this session Agenda Computer User.

Similar presentations


Presentation on theme: "About me About this session Agenda Computer User."— Presentation transcript:

1

2

3 About me

4

5 About this session

6 Agenda

7

8

9

10 Computer User

11

12 Group policy vs. Configuration Manager Group policy software installationsConfiguration Manager Group policy software installations client side extension ConfigMgr Client → ConfigMgr Software Distribution Agent (ccmexec.exe) Msi package (or.zap file)Any command line Install and uninstall out of the boxPackage model: install and uninstall separate Application model: installation program required, uninstall program recommended Writes Event ID's, but no centralized reporting Extensive and exhaustive reports and logging

13 Group policy vs. Configuration Manager Group policy software installationsConfiguration Manager Based on active directory and organizational units Collections and database Information can be read from AD Targeting using organizational unitsTargeting using collections Additional targeting using group policy security filtering Queries, direct membership Application Model: requirements Msi package → assign/publishPackage model: Package → Program → Advertisement Application model: deployment types

14 Group policy vs. Configuration Manager Group policy software installationsConfiguration Manager If msi package and targeted computer are ok, everything just works (or that's what we think) Whether software distribution action was successful or not we get the information. Return codes are important! Sequencing possible using "GPO Link Order" Package installation order within the same GPO is assumed to be random Package model: "Run another program first" Task Sequences Application Model: requirements, dependencies Makes sure the client computer is in the state that msi package defines Makes sure the command line will be run on client - eventually

15 Group policy vs. Configuration Manager Group policy software installationsConfiguration Manager No scheduling optionsDeployments can be scheduled DFS root → DFS share → directory → msi package (Install source) Package Source Files → Distribution Point → ConfigMgr cache Install source is immutableConfigMgr Windows Installer Source List Management

16

17

18 Domain Group policy software installations Client GPO Software Installations Client Side Extension Windows Installer Msi package GPO Computer User

19

20

21

22

23

24

25 Msi package Windows installer self-healing (self-repair) Component A (GUID A) File 1 Keypath for Component A File 2 Component B (GUID B) Registry Key 1 Keypath for Component B File 3 Windows installer Check Repair Check Repair

26

27

28

29

30

31

32

33

34

35

36

37

38 Group policy vs. Configuration Manager Group policy software installationsConfiguration Manager Publish to userAdvertisement, non-mandatory to computer Only domain accountsFor all accounts (Domain, Local) Installing account: user with elevated privileges Installing account: Local System or the user logged on No notifications about new softwareOption for notifications about new software

39

40

41

42

43

44

45 Start Blocking Per-Machine installations? Blocking Per-User installations? Notify user Blocking process running? Notify user, try again? No Yes No Yes No Yes No Yes Quit: -1 (per-machine) Quit: -2 (per-user) Quit: -3 (blocking process) A

46 Program already installed? Install program? Notify user: installation finished Run uninstall command Quit: Return Code from uninstall command Reboot needed? No Yes No Yes No Yes Program already installed? No Quit: 0 (no changes) No Quit: -4 (user gave up) Yes Run install command Quit: Return Code from install command Schedule reboot in 60 seconds Notify user: reboot is needed A Uninstall program? Wait of 'OK'

47

48

49 Group policy vs. Configuration Manager Group policy software InstallationsConfiguration Manager Install during startup (boot) "Installing Managed Application..." Install at any time (except during startup) Whether user is logged on or not Uninstall during startup (boot)Uninstall at any time (except during startup) Installing account: Local SystemInstalling account: Local System (Run with administrative rights) or any other account

50

51

52

53

54 Domain Keksi Computer HKLM\SOFTWARE\[Wow6432Node\] Microsoft\Windows\CurrentVersion\Uninstall\ GPOInstall Adobe Reader\ DisplayName="GPOInstall Adobe Reader" GPO: "Install Adobe Reader"Startup script: "\\server\share\keksi-adobereader.vbs" Configuration Manager Configuration Manager client Hardware inventory cycle Add/Remove Programs "GPOInstall Adobe Reader" Computer Collection "GPO: Install Adobe Reader" Query Add/Remove Programs Display Name = GPOInstall Adobe Reader Install or upgrade Adobe Reader 1 2 3 4 5

55

56

57

58

59 Complete your session evaluations today and enter to win prizes daily. Provide your feedback at a CommNet kiosk or log on at www.2013mms.com. Upon submission you will receive instant notification if you have won a prize. Prize pickup is at the Information Desk located in Attendee Services in the Mandalay Bay Foyer. Entry details can be found on the MMS website.

60 Resources

61


Download ppt "About me About this session Agenda Computer User."

Similar presentations


Ads by Google